Masonry Waterproofing in Redmond, WA
Masonry waterproofing services focus on protecting stone, brick, concrete, and other masonry surfaces from water intrusion and damage. These services typically involve applying specialized sealants, coatings, or waterproof barriers to the exterior or interior of masonry structures, including foundations, retaining walls, and decorative facades. Property owners often seek this service to prevent issues like cracking, efflorescence,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by moisture infiltration,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or freeze-thaw cycles like Redmond, WA.
Before requesting masonry waterproofing,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including which surfaces need treatment and the types of waterproofing materials used. It’s important to consider the existing condition of the masonry, as repairs or cleaning may be necessary prior to waterproofing application. Additionally, understanding how waterproofing can extend the lifespan of masonry structures and protect property value helps hom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ining their buildings against ongoing exposure to moisture.

Common Masonry Waterproofing Jobs
Foundation Wall Waterproofing - protects basement walls from water infiltration and moisture damage.
Cement Masonry Waterproofing - prevents water penetration in brick, block, and stone surfaces.
Retaining Wall Waterproofing - helps maintain structural integrity by managing water runoff.
Chimney Waterproofing - shields masonry chimneys from water damage and freeze-thaw cycles.
Paver and Patio Waterproofing - reduces water seepage to extend the lifespan of outdoor surfaces.
Cavity Wall Waterproofing - prevents moisture buildup between wall layers, preserving interior conditions.
Masonry Waterproofing Questions
What is masonry waterproofing? Masonry waterproofing involves applying protective treatments to brick, stone, or concrete surfaces to prevent water penetration and damage.
Which structures benefit from masonry waterproofing? Foundations, basement walls, retaining walls, and exterior facades commonly receive masonry waterproofing to enhance durability.
How does waterproofing protect a property? It helps prevent water infiltration that can lead to structural issues, mold growth, and interior water damage.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Common methods include sealants, membranes, and coatings designed to suit different masonry surfaces and exposure conditions.
